Kinds of Treadmills
When it comes to selecting a treadmill, it is important to understand the different types offered in the market. Here are the main categories:
1. Manual TreadmillsMechanism: These treadmills have a basic style and depend on the user's efforts to move the belt.Pros: More economical, quieter operation, no electrical energy required.Cons: Limited features, might not supply the very same range of exercise strength.2. Motorized TreadmillsSystem: Powered by a motor that drives the belt, enabling users to stroll or run at a set pace.Pros: Greater range of speeds and slopes, geared up with various functions such as heart rate screens and workout programs.Cons: More expensive and might need more upkeep.3. Folding TreadmillsMechanism: Designed for those with minimal space, these treadmills can be folded for easy storage.Pros: Space-saving, frequently motorized, versatile functions.Cons: May be less long lasting than non-folding designs.4. Commercial TreadmillsMechanism: High-quality machines developed for usage in fitness centers and physical fitness centers.Pros: Built to endure heavy usage, advanced features, often include service warranties.Cons: Pricey and not perfect for home usage due to size.5. Treadmills provide various advantages that can contribute to one's general health and fitness goals. Some of these benefits include:

When selecting a treadmill, possible buyers need to think about numerous key aspects:

How often should I use a treadmill?
It is recommended to use a treadmill at least 3 to 5 times a week, incorporating various strength levels for best results.
2. Can I reduce weight by utilizing a treadmill?
Yes, constant usage of a treadmill can contribute to weight loss, especially when combined with a well balanced diet and strength training.
3. What is the very best speed to walk on a treadmill for newbies?
A speed of 3 to 4 miles per hour is a suitable variety for newbies. It's important to begin slow and gradually increase rate as convenience and stamina enhance.
4. Do I require to use a treadmill if I already run outdoors?
Using a treadmill can offer fringe benefits, such as regulated environments and differed workouts (slope, periods) that are not constantly possible outdoors.
5. How do I preserve my treadmill?
Routine upkeep consists of lubing the belt, cleaning up the deck and console, and checking the motor for optimal efficiency.
